WezV has made me a lap steel which I picked up at Christmas. I see that they are becoming more popular and they are great fun to make a noise on, though a bit harder to actually play well! This web site gives you lots of tuning and playing tips and is great for anyone thinking of getting one
http://www.well.com/~wellvis/steel.html
.
It is resting next to my WezV SG and leaning against my Ceriatone JTM 18/45 (18w TMB/EF86 preamp, JTM 45 power amp), with a Scumback M75 LHDC in the Matamp cab and a Celestion Sidewinder in the Ear Candy cab.
